We used this for a children's holiday club. It was inexpensive and although the younger children (age 7) initially squeezed it too hard they soon were able to control the flow of paint. It dried fine but when the outside of the vase we had decorated got wet the paint also became liquid so that was not ideal for our purpose.

Just to let you know the paint is more opaque than transparent, when used thick to get a good depth of colour, light will not shine through! also once dry it peels off, just as well as I needed it to be translucent, great for children to mess on with.
